Transaction 36c373040190aab710a9c2ebebbb88490281498588fc67acf4cc71dd1a048637

1 Input
2 Outputs
  • 36c373040190aab710a9c2ebebbb88490281498588fc67acf4cc71dd1a048637:0
  • value  7176687887
    address  37A9xRK26DehX8yuuZem2Uc8WxaPDYt2Uv
  • 36c373040190aab710a9c2ebebbb88490281498588fc67acf4cc71dd1a048637:1
  • value  61040855
    address  39AEBzS96iYqPewLsPWPSKyttZA35HRFLx